Simple goober search....

Christmas was first officially celebrated on December 25, 336 CE, in Rome. The date was chosen to coincide with pagan winter festivals, such as the Saturnalia and the Sol Invictus celebration, potentially as a way to co-opt and Christianize these popular holidays. Some historians also believe the December 25 date was chosen because it is nine months after the traditional date of Christ's conception, which is celebrated on March 25.

Yule was an ancient Germanic and Norse winter festival, centered on the winter solstice (the shortest day), celebrating the rebirth of the sun, feasting, and honoring gods, which later influenced many Christmas traditions like evergreens, gift-giving, and the Yule log. Modern Pagans and Wiccans still celebrate it as a sabbat marking the longest night and the sun's return, focusing on light, warmth, and seasonal cycles.
